    Biography of Lisa 'Left Eye' Lopes

    Brief Overview of Lisa's Life

    Lisa 'Left Eye' Lopes was born on March 27, 1971,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Her unique nickname, "Left Eye," was inspired by her habit of wearing a pair of glasses with only the left lens. This became her signature look and set her apart in the entertainment world. Lisa was not just a performer; she was a voice for women's empowerment and gender equality.

    Early Life and Career Beginnings

    Lisa Lopes grew up in a musical family, which influenced her passion for music from an early age. She attended Philadelphia's High School for the Creative and Performing Arts, where she honed her skills in singing and songwriting. Her early career saw her performing in local clubs and talent shows, showcasing her unique style and vocal talent.

    Her big break came when she joined TLC in 1990. The group quickly became one of the most successful acts in music history, earning numerous awards and breaking records with their chart-topping hits. Lisa's role in TLC was pivotal, bringing a fiery and authentic presence to the group.

    The TLC Journey: Rise to Fame

    Key Achievements and Contributions

    TLC, consisting of Lisa 'Left Eye' Lopes, Tionne 'T-Boz' Watkins, and Rozonda 'Chilli' Thomas, revolutionized the music industry with their debut album "Ooooooohhh... On the TLC Tip" in 1992. The album produced several hit singles, including "Ain't 2 Proud 2 Beg," which reached number one on the charts.

    During their career, TLC earned numerous accolades, including four Grammy Awards. Lisa's contributions to the group were significant, both as a rapper and as a songwriter. Her lyrics often addressed social issues, such as safe sex and female empowerment, resonating with a global audience.

    Lisa 'Left Eye' Lopes Death Cause

    The tragic death of Lisa 'Left Eye' Lopes occurred on April 25, 2002, in Honduras. The cause of her death was a car accident, which took the lives of three other individuals. This devastating event shocked the world and left a void in the music industry.
